  • Patent number: 5174852
    Abstract: In a method for attaching labels to containers, the labels are removed from a stack by rolling contact with an adhesive surface coated with a cold glue. Prior to termination of the removing step, a localized hot glue coating is in addition applied to the foremost label in the stack. After the label has thus been coated with cold glue and hot glue, it is peeled of the adhesive surface and pressed into contact of its glue-coated backside with a container. The provision that the hot glue coating is applied to the label while it is still held in the magazine ensures that the shape and position of the hot glue coating is fully independent of the speed of the labelling operation.

  • Patent number: 5147023
    Abstract: Method and installation for converting multi-track flow of containers into a single track flow, wherein an infeed conveyor is slanted relative to the horizontal plane, an intermediate conveyor is slanted at the same angle and so is a discharge conveyor. The intermediate conveyor is at least as wide as the infeed conveyor and abuts onto it. The discharge conveyor is arranged parallel and lateral to the intermediate conveyor. There is a cross-over plate between the infeed and intermediate conveyors. The advanced containers are first pushed onto the cross-over plate by the containers coming in on the infeed conveyor and they remain abreast of each other as they are then pushed onto the intermediate conveyor, whereby they are gradually accelerated to a speed which is lower than the speed of the discharge conveyor.

  • Patent number: 5116452
    Abstract: Apparatus for applying labels to spinning and translating containers has a rotating vacuum cylinder almost touching the containers. The printed sides of individual labels are deposited on the vacuum cylinder at which time fingers grip the leading end of the label to prevent the label from being attracted to an ensuing glue roller which has plural annular grooves and applies a strip of glue to the leading end of the label. The leading and trailing ends are also held by vacuum devices which are cam driven to extend by a small amount radially of the vacuum cylinder. The fingers register in the grooves of the roller so they do not interfere. The label on the cylinder is carried on the cylinder and secured at its trailing end by its own radially movable vacuum device. When the trailing end reaches a second glue roller the latter device moves radially outward of the cylinder to pick up a strip of glue on the trailing end.

  • Patent number: 5065799
    Abstract: In apparatus for filling cans with beverage the can is coupled to the filler valve and purged of atmospheric air with a mostly inert gas and air mixture derived from the space of the liquid in a storage tank. When the exhaust valve is closed, another valve opens to permit pure inert gas stored in a reservoir to flow into the can and pressurize it to slightly above atmospheric pressure but below the pressure in the storage tank. A pre-pressurization valve is then opened to let some of the inert gas and air mixture in the storage tank flow to the can which is occupied by the substantially pure inert gas so practically none of the downflowing gas and air mixture from the storage tank enters the can although it fills the chamber to which the can is connected and thereby pressurizes the can. When the can pressure and storage tank pressure become equal, a liquid control valve opens to drain liquid from the tank into the can.

  • Patent number: 4922775
    Abstract: Apparatus for cutting labels from a ribbon on which the labels are printed. The ribbon is fed into the apparatus along a vertical plane, for instance. There are vertically spaced apart knives adjacent the ribbon for cutting the upper and lower contours of the labels from the ribbon. The knives are caused to pivot toward the ribbon and to rise and fall under the influence of a cam that is shaped correspondingly with the desired contours. After the upper and lower contours are formed the ribbon is caused to change direction around a roller while at the same time the trim margin is deflected in another direction and drawn away. The ribbon, with labels still connected endwise is fed over a vacuum cylinder which has cutters at its periphery for separating the labels from a waste portion between them. The labels are removed from the vacuum cylinder and led to a label applying machine, as an example.

  • Patent number: 4898271
    Abstract: In apparatus for the signaling of a back-up in a container conveyor, the actual translation speed of all containers passing a measuring zone is determined separately with the aid of the measuring of the transit time and compared with the simultaneously measured momentary travel velocity of a hinge-belt-chain conveyor. If the translation speed of the containers is smaller by a determined amount than the travel velocity, or in a predetermined relationship, a jam or back-up signal is produced. The device has two photodetectors arranged at the same level with a fixed spacing in the direction of bottle transportation. A sensor registers the presence of a bottle in the measuring zone. A tachometer generator is attached to the drive shaft of the conveyor and provides an analog signal to a processor indicative of conveyor speed.

  • Patent number: 4790662
    Abstract: Empty bottles are checked for foreign bodies and other contamination by passing the bottles successively through two inspection zones in which they are optoelectronically scanned while they are on rotating disks that are mounted on a rotating table. When in one inspection zone a bottle is held stable on the disk by a rotatable socket that grips the bottle mouth to allow a clear view for inspecting down to the bottom. When in the other inspection zone the bottle is engaged by a ring at about shoulder height so there is a clear view for inspection of the bottle portion from the shoulder to the mouth. In transition regions between inspection zones the ring and socket both engage the bottle for a moment and then one gripper is withdrawn while the other remains to hold the bottle in the forthcoming inspection zone.

  • Patent number: 4637438
    Abstract: Containers such as bottles, which are to be filled with liquid from a tank pressurized with non-oxidizing gas, are coupled to a filling device and evacuated of air that is discharged to the atmosphere. Next gas from the tank is fed to the bottles. When gas pressure in the tank and bottle equalize, the liquid flows by gravity into the bottle to displace the gas and return it to the tank. After filling with liquid is cut off a charge of pure non-oxidizing gas is injected in the bottle to fill it to the top with pure gas. Excess pure gas is fed back into the tank to make up for the dilution of the gas that results from the evacuation of air from the bottles being necessarily imperfect. The bottles are uncoupled from the device after they are filled with pure gas and they are then sealed.
